TWO MONTHS MORE: Kotoko have not contacted us about Ganiyu extension – Yusif Chibsah

Asante Kotoko are yet to enter into renewal talks with influential defender Abdul Ganiyu Ismail despite entering the final months of his contract with the club, his agent claims.

The centre-back’s current deal with the Reds ends in October this year but his representatives are yet to be notified of any extension.

Yusif Alhassan Chibsah, the owner of Club Consult Africa which represents Ganiyu revealed the current state of the player to Pure FM.

“Kotoko has not contacted us on Ganiu’s stay, whether renewal or departure. His contract ends in October.

“Maybe he will stay, maybe he will move on but everything depends on Asante Kotoko so we can only wait for them,” he stated.

Ganiu joined Asante Kotoko in 2018 and is now a regular in the Black Stars setup of coach Charles Akonnor.

He will be expected to feature for Ghana against Ethiopia and South Africa in the 2022 Fifa World Cup qualifiers in September.
